If you're new to this market, I would be hesitant to allocate any capital until we see what's going on with bitcoin. Personally, I see it going to at least $10,500, but it wouldn't be the first time I was wrong. Regardless, the market is heavily correlated to bitcoin, and a lot of leading figure heads warned of an impending bear market.

I don't know if any of that is true, but BTC is not looking good right now in my opinion. Also, I don't like how the market is moving up so high on such low volume, particularly since it has such high volatility.

The broader market also moves up with low volume often, but anytime volatility starts to rise, there are liquidity injections into the market in order to stabilize it and keep it moving up and keep the general public complacent.

I'm not sure that this market has that type of infrastructure. Actually, I'm sure it does to a certain extent based on my observations, but I don't know if they will save anyone in this market at this time.

I just wish BTC would hurry up and do something so we can all get back on with our lives.
